Responsibilities

 

  • * Inspect and validate critical processes to ensure alignment with established ISO policies and procedures Define and execute specific customer and agency quality requirements as they pertain to the products being developed and manufactured Develop, validate, maintain and implement inspection plans for new product launches Assist in the identification of critical steps in processes to aid in the training of associates Participate in the development, implementation and maintenance of process controls and reaction plans Investigate and define corrective and preventative actions pertaining to defective components, materials and products Participate in supplier development and selection audits, including both domestic and possibly foreign suppliers Manage Customer Quality Notification (CQN) reports and Internal Quality Notification (IQN) reports and any other corrective action requests Participate as a member of the internal ISO audit team as needed Assist with implementing and maintaining 6S initiatives as they apply to this functional area Partner with the incoming inspection department to create quality plans for purchased material

Qualifications

 

Strong verbal, written, and presentation skills Experience in an ISO 9001: 2015 manufacturing environment Solid interpersonal skills and the ability to communicate in a positive and proactive way Proven ability to effectively lead projects, manage multiple tasks, solve technical problems, work effectively in cross-functional teams. Excellent computer skills with experience in Microsoft Excel, Word, PowerPoint and Project Experience in the Six Sigma DMAIC process Ability to perform in a team oriented environment. Demonstrated success in driving execution - act independently, take initiative, and follow assignment through to completion

 

Education and experience required:

 

Bachelor of Science degree in Mechanical, Electrical, Electrochemical or related Engineering discipline from an ABET-accredited institution, or in the Natural Sciences or related technical discipline.

This position is available at three different career levels depending on experience, education, etc.:

o Level 3 (Senior Staff): 5 years relevant Quality Engineering and/or related Engineering experience

 

o Level 2 (Staff Engineer III): 3 years relevant Quality Engineering or related Engineering Experience

 

o Level 1 (Staff Engineer II): 2 years relevant Quality Engineering or related Engineering Experience

MS degree may be substituted for up to 2 years of relevant experience. PhD may be substituted for up to 4 years of equivalent experience.
